4-Day Pune Panchgani Karjat Itinerary

Viewed by 63 travelers
Friday, November 10: Pune

Morning: Start your day by visiting the iconic Shaniwar Wada, an ancient fortification in Pune. Explore the historical significance and architectural beauty of this landmark. In the afternoon, head to Aga Khan Palace, a grand palace known for its history and beautiful gardens. As the evening approaches, take a peaceful walk along the Mula River and enjoy the serene atmosphere.

  • Shaniwar Wada: Estimated cost: INR 100 per person, Time spent: 2 hours
  • Aga Khan Palace: Estimated cost: INR 50 per person, Time spent: 2 hours
  • Mula River: Free, Time spent: 1 hour
Saturday, November 11: Pune to Panchgani

Morning: Start early and drive to the hill station of Panchgani. Explore Table Land, a vast plateau offering panoramic views and various activities like horse riding and paragliding. In the afternoon, visit Mapro Garden, a lush garden famous for its strawberry products. Later, relax and enjoy the scenic beauty of Sydney Point, a viewpoint providing magnificent vistas of the surrounding valleys.

  • Table Land: Estimated cost: INR 50 per person, Time spent: 2-3 hours
  • Mapro Garden: Estimated cost: Free entry, Time spent: 1 hour
  • Sydney Point: Estimated cost: Free, Time spent: 1-2 hours
Sunday, November 12: Panchgani

Morning: Begin your day with a visit to the picturesque Kaas Plateau, known for its stunning array of wildflowers and vibrant landscapes. Spend a couple of hours enjoying the natural beauty and taking memorable photographs. In the afternoon, explore the popular tourist spot of Dhom Dam, where you can indulge in boating and enjoy serene views of the reservoir. End the day with a visit to Parsi Point, a viewpoint offering breathtaking vistas of the hill station.

  • Kaas Plateau: Estimated cost: INR 100 per person, Time spent: 2 hours
  • Dhom Dam: Estimated cost: Free entry, Time spent: 1-2 hours
  • Parsi Point: Estimated cost: Free, Time spent: 1 hour
Monday, November 13: Panchgani to Karjat

Morning: Leave Panchgani and travel to the scenic town of Karjat. Start your day with a trek to Kondana Caves, ancient Buddhist caves known for their historical and architectural significance. In the afternoon, visit Bhivpuri Waterfalls, a beautiful waterfall nestled amidst lush greenery. Spend some time enjoying the refreshing waters. Later, explore the serene Ulhas Valley and take a leisurely stroll amidst nature.

  • Kondana Caves: Estimated cost: INR 10 per person, Time spent: 2-3 hours
  • Bhivpuri Waterfalls: Estimated cost: Free entry, Time spent: 1-2 hours
  • Ulhas Valley: Estimated cost: Free, Time spent: 1 hour

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

If you're traveling with a dog, don't miss out on visiting the Peth Fort in Peth Shahpur, a dog-friendly fort with a rich history. Take your furry friend on a walk while exploring the fort and enjoying panoramic views. Another hidden gem is the Dongri Waterfalls near Karjat, a secluded spot where you can enjoy a peaceful time with your dog amidst nature's beauty. Remember to pack essentials like food, water, and waste bags for your furry companion.
